Summary

Chloe has one plan for the future, and one plan only: the road. She's made a promise to herself: don't let anyone in, and don't let anyone love her. She's learned the hard way what happens if she breaks her rules. So she's focused on being invisible and waiting until she can set out on the road--her dream of freedom, at least for a little while.

Blake Hunter is a basketball star who has it all--everything about him looks perfect to those on the other side of his protective walls. He can't let anyone see the shattered pieces behind the flawless facade or else all his hopes and dreams will disappear.

One dark night throws Chloe and Blake together, changing everything for Blake. For Chloe, nothing changes: she has the road, and she's focused on it. But when the so-called perfect boy starts to notice the invisible girl, they discover that sometimes with love, no one knows where the road may lead.

Amazing audio

Holy Moly, what a book.
The emotion portrayed by the narrators was heartbreakingly beautiful.

The developing relationship between Chloe and Blake was filled with so many ups and downs it sometimes made my head spin.
Blake was everything you would want in a partner. Sweet, considerate, caring, charming, honest, and loving.
While I understood why Chloe was the way she was, I sometimes felt like she was taking away people's choices. She was so stubborn in her belief that she was better off being invisible, that I felt like she was missing out on many opportunities.

I loved the way that Blake worked his magic with her; wormed his way under her armour, and broke down her carefully constructed walls. to see her open herself up the way she did was so satisfying.

And the ending? Gah, it just about gutted me. Talk about heart palpitations. Well played, Mrs McLean, well played.

Didn’t like for various reasons...

First—when I started reading & listening, obviously, I thought I was a good story. Boy meets girl falls in love. That would be Blake & Chloe. Blake has the most obnoxious, mean, cheater that even though he falls for Chloe, she doesn’t break up with his nasty girlfriend for a while, which I didn’t understand—but that’s no big deal here. Chloe is in a foster home due to problems but will NOT allow her to be a REAL part of her family, nor will she allow herself to get seriously close to Blake due to her ‘issue’ *NO SPOILERS*

Here’s why I just wasn’t happy—If we the Reader were not told by the characters that they were ONLY in High School I’d swear you’d be thinking these were adults with their every other word! Either “MF F***head, S***Face, F BOMBS in EVERY chapter. It was COMPLETELY unnecessary for a book actually released thru “Amazon’s Children’s Publishing” this is NOT a children’s book and I have 5 adult kids who I know would say the same thing! Believe me I’m no prude, I may not say the F Bomb out loud, but unfortunately we probably think it and say it under our breathe, but I’m also an ADULT—these are supposed to be 17 or 18 yr old teenagers not 20 or 30 something year olds? I just didn’t see the reason behind this? I think when I heard Chloe’s “foster” brother who really isn’t, (long story) and I know he is under 16 or even younger say to her in one chapter “Get the F out of my room, you don’t F love anybody..” And I promise he says it in one sentence after another over and over to her out of anger—WAS IT NECESSARY? Nope

Some reviewers will say “Well you’re being picky & petty! It was a great young love story!” And that it was but—I don’t like those words, I don’t like hearing them over & over nor do I like seeing them in print!!

Yes it’s a sweet love story but it was too fairytale ending, a weird uneventful road trip, and too predictable at a lot of parts.

The only excellent part was Nick Podehl as ‘Blake’ he is a fabulous narrator, I’ve listened to his character of ‘Billy Cunningham’ and I think he’s great..as far as Laura Hamilton she was good as Chloe but as a boys voice it just sounded weird...

I’m sorry if all the ones who laughed and cried hate this review then you don’t mind hearing kids cursing—rather listening or reading those words—but I did and that’s why not all reviews are identical. I can only recommend this book for the parts of the love story that were not laden with cursing.
